Postby Ship called Dignity » Thu Jul 07, 2005 12:05 am

Bought another Courier today and the beginner lessons are being held on Sundays and Tuesdays at Machrihanish with free transport provided. Lessons are for 12 year olds and over. .

Cost is £10 for Young Scot cardholders and £20 for those without - this includes all surf equipment.

Postby Ship called Dignity » Fri Jul 08, 2005 10:40 pm

Received the following e-mail from Mid Argyll Swimming Pool today:-

Kintyre Surf School

Lessons are geared towards Learners and Improvers aged 12 years and over, and will be running on Tuesdays and Sundays from July to October. All surf equipment is provided, all you need to bring is:

Swimsuit
Towel
Something to eat and drink
Shampoo: showers available back at pool
Camera!

Booking is easy! For booking or more information please contact the swimming pool or drop in to pick up a booking form. Please return completed forms and payment to the pool (cheques made payable to: Mid Argyll Swimming Pool).

Lessons can be booked individually or as a series.

The cost will be £10 for Young Scot card holders and £20 for everyone else.

Dates include:

July: 12th 17th 19th 26th 31st
August: 2nd 21st
September: 4th 18th
October: 2nd 16th
